Home
last modified time | relevance | path

Searched defs:bus_space (Results 1 – 4 of 4) sorted by relevance

/openbsd/sys/arch/arm/include/
H A Dbus.h91 struct bus_space { struct
97 int, bus_space_handle_t *); argument
106 bus_addr_t *, bus_space_handle_t *); argument
107 void (*bs_free) (void *, bus_space_handle_t, argument
117 void (*bs_barrier) (void *, bus_space_handle_t, argument
131 void (*bs_rm_1) (void *, bus_space_handle_t, argument
133 void (*bs_rm_2) (void *, bus_space_handle_t, argument
151 void (*bs_w_1) (void *, bus_space_handle_t, argument
153 void (*bs_w_2) (void *, bus_space_handle_t, argument
155 void (*bs_w_4) (void *, bus_space_handle_t, argument
[all …]
/openbsd/sys/arch/powerpc64/include/
H A Dbus.h42 struct bus_space { struct
45 uint8_t (*_space_read_1)(bus_space_tag_t , bus_space_handle_t, argument
47 void (*_space_write_1)(bus_space_tag_t , bus_space_handle_t, argument
51 void (*_space_write_2)(bus_space_tag_t , bus_space_handle_t, argument
55 void (*_space_write_4)(bus_space_tag_t , bus_space_handle_t, argument
59 void (*_space_write_8)(bus_space_tag_t , bus_space_handle_t, argument
73 int (*_space_map)(bus_space_tag_t , bus_addr_t, argument
75 void (*_space_unmap)(bus_space_tag_t, bus_space_handle_t, argument
77 int (*_space_subregion)(bus_space_tag_t, bus_space_handle_t, argument
79 void * (*_space_vaddr)(bus_space_tag_t, bus_space_handle_t); argument
[all …]
/openbsd/sys/arch/arm64/include/
H A Dbus.h47 struct bus_space { struct
50 u_int8_t (*_space_read_1)(bus_space_tag_t , bus_space_handle_t, argument
52 void (*_space_write_1)(bus_space_tag_t , bus_space_handle_t, argument
56 void (*_space_write_2)(bus_space_tag_t , bus_space_handle_t, argument
60 void (*_space_write_4)(bus_space_tag_t , bus_space_handle_t, argument
64 void (*_space_write_8)(bus_space_tag_t , bus_space_handle_t, argument
78 int (*_space_map)(bus_space_tag_t , bus_addr_t, argument
80 void (*_space_unmap)(bus_space_tag_t, bus_space_handle_t, argument
82 int (*_space_subregion)(bus_space_tag_t, bus_space_handle_t, argument
84 void * (*_space_vaddr)(bus_space_tag_t, bus_space_handle_t); argument
[all …]
/openbsd/sys/arch/riscv64/include/
H A Dbus.h48 struct bus_space { struct
51 u_int8_t (*_space_read_1)(bus_space_tag_t , bus_space_handle_t, argument
53 void (*_space_write_1)(bus_space_tag_t , bus_space_handle_t, argument
57 void (*_space_write_2)(bus_space_tag_t , bus_space_handle_t, argument
61 void (*_space_write_4)(bus_space_tag_t , bus_space_handle_t, argument
65 void (*_space_write_8)(bus_space_tag_t , bus_space_handle_t, argument
79 int (*_space_map)(bus_space_tag_t , bus_addr_t, argument
81 void (*_space_unmap)(bus_space_tag_t, bus_space_handle_t, argument
83 int (*_space_subregion)(bus_space_tag_t, bus_space_handle_t, argument
85 void * (*_space_vaddr)(bus_space_tag_t, bus_space_handle_t); argument
[all …]